Situated in the heart of Soajo village, near the pillory in the central square. It's an old house, century-old building in granite stone and settings reminiscent of medieval times. The house was restored by the new owners with a view to combining the old trace charm with the amenities of modern times.
Ideal for weekends, weeks or vacation for those seeking a relaxing break in lovely surroundings, wrapped in the peace of the Natural Park Peneda Geres. Stunning scenery, several ponds at a distance of a short walk and trails for those seeking the adventure of discovery.

Ground floor: former court to animals, now transformed into a room that can be double or bed XL bed as user preferences. It has a built-in wardrobe fact, storage and exit to outside patio.
Room: Very good lighting. Old flirt window that connects with the kitchen. Rustic table with seating for 6 persons. Flat TV, DVD player and external disk. Fireplace and comfortable chairs rest. In one corner there is a closet from which comes a folding double bed and a retractable wall to ensure privacy.
Bathroom: Whe the granite walls contrast with modern equipment, with all the amenities including a hairdryer.
Kitchen: Lovely, located in a covered balcony with table for breakfast. Fully equipped with modern stove and oven, all appliances (fridge, blender, electric grinder, coffee machine, microwave) prepared for confecionar light meals or snacks prepared.
Outer space: Several places with large patio, with a network ideal shade to rest in warmer weather. Lawned garden with stone table under the trellis and organic garden with vegetables on offer to customers. Ideal for a portable grill roasts taste!

  • Graham W.

    Submitted Sep 11, 2017

    Stayed Aug 18, 2017

    Overall we had a pleasant week in Soajo with some highs and lows. The highs. Lovely authentic granite stone house. Really friendly neighbours. A generous welcome from the owner with cake, bread, wine and access to stores. The owner was flexible about arrival and leaving times which really helped especially as we had a late flight home. My children loved lounging on the hammock and feeding the cats. The local “Pocos” (Waterfall plunge pools) were wonderful and we really recommend finding Ponta de Ladeira for tranquil bathing. The lows. It’s important to note that in the week that we went temperatures reached over 35c daily also there was four of us staying, so the little house was full - but I think its important that future visitors should be prepared: Sleeping is very difficult; upstairs the bed is a pull down steel bed and very very noisy - we ended up having to sleep on the floor. There is no fan or any other method to keep cool on hot nights. Sleeping was not helped by the fact that the local young people like to race quad bikes late into the night (Until 3am most nights). The shower leaks badly and we had to put rugs in the room downstairs to catch the water. The small fridge finds it hard to keep things cool on a hot day and needs replacing. There is little room to store your food provisions, toiletries or clothing. The cats although lovely, can be an issue if, like me, you are badly allergic to them - I had to take antihistamines all week. Also we preferred not to use the small garden area as this is where the cats go to the toilet. You cannot park your car near the house, we had our hire car vandalised whilst parked in the town car park. Be prepared to find things for yourself as the tourist information office is unhelpful and there are no signs how to get to any of the Poco swimming areas. In summary if only two of you are staying, you ‘re OK with cats, know the local area and it is not too hot - then you’ll have a lovely time staying here. But if it’s hot and the house is full you may well find it uncomfortable.
